EXHIBIT "A" <br />SCOPE OF SERVICES <br />The scope of work for Amendment No. 3 is described below <br />(1) Design of Custom Structures Aesthetics <br />Background <br />Consultant's Original Agreement Scope of Services (Task 2.12 Landscape/Aesthetics <br />Concept Plan) included standard structure aesthetics. The standard structure <br />aesthetics are indicated in the Project Report, the Environmental Document, and the <br />Visual Impact Analysis Report. There was no custom structure aesthetics request <br />made during the Project Approval & Environmental Document Phase. The Original <br />Agreement only included the level of effort required to prepare and provide standard <br />structure aesthetics. The City would now like to enhance the structure aesthetics by <br />providing custom structure aesthetics for certain structures. Figure 1 illustrates standard <br />and custom structure aesthetic features. <br />Scope of Work <br />Consultant will complete the additional services described below, which are necessary <br />to provide custom structures aesthetics as part of the PS&E and R/W Support Phase of <br />the 101/84 (Woodside Road) Interchange Improvement Project. <br />Provide Custom Structures Aesthetics — Consultant will provide custom structure <br />aesthetics into the design. This Task will include the following subtasks: <br />1. Initial Conceptual Drawings - Design and create conceptual drawings for one set <br />of custom aesthetics for retaining walls 720, 538, 333 and 115. <br />2. City Review - Correspond with the City and submit Initial Conceptual Drawings to <br />the City for review. <br />3. Incorporate City Comments - Upon receipt of City comments, revise the designs <br />and create one revised set of alternatives for the same walls as noted in subtask <br />1. <br />4. Conceptual Drawings (revision 1) - Correspond with City and provide responses <br />to comments and updated Conceptual Drawings. At same time, submit <br />Conceptual Drawings to Caltrans. <br />5. Caltrans Review - Receive comments from Caltrans and discuss. <br />6. Conceptual Drawings (revision 2) - Upon receipt of comments from Caltrans, <br />prepare two conceptual alternatives that respond to Caltrans comments. <br />7. Caltrans Review #2 — Correspond with Caltrans and submit two conceptual <br />alternatives to Caltrans for walls noted in item 1. <br />8. Final Conceptual Drawings - Receive Caltrans comments & respond by <br />redesigning one set of alternatives for the walls and finalizing the Conceptual <br />Drawings. <br />REV: 07-03-19 DZ <br />ATTY/AGR.Amend No. 3/AECOM 101/84 PS&E Page 3of13 <br />
